Norway striker John Carew has encouraged Martin Andresen to leave Blackburn and head for Spain. Carew, currently on loan at Roma from Valencia, moved to Spain in 2000 and believes a similar switch would be ideal for his international captain.
"Martin Andresen has a great talent, but I don't think that England is the right arena for him," Carew told Norwegian newspaper VG.
"I think Spain would be much better for him and I'd advise him to go there."
Andresen has made only eight appearances for Blackburn since arriving at Ewood Park from Stabaek in February.
